okay, as this list I had in that other thread seems to be rather wrong and incomplete, lets make a better one!
Here´s the list so far, its your turn to complete / correct it! :)

Metallians, Headbangers, Metal People, Metalheads etc. seems to be international.

Albania: Metalist or Metalari
Argentina: Metaleros
Austria Metler or Metla
Belgium: hard-rockeurs, Metal Heads, Hardrockers, Metallers
Brazil: Metaleiros
Canada: dirties, Bangers
Chile: Metaleros, Metalicos, rockeros
Czech: Metalisti, Metly
Denmark: Rockers
England: Goffs, (Greebos)
Finland: Metallisti
France: Hardrockers
Germany: Metaller (Metaler)
Greece: Metallades or, in early '80s, Heavymetallades
Hungary: Metalosok
Israel: Metalistim
Italy: Metallari, Metalloni
India: Metalheads
Luxembourg: Metaller
Netherlands: Hardrockers
Portugal: Metalicos
Puerto Rico: Metallicos
Romania: Metalisti
Russia: Metalist
Slovenia: Metalci
Spain: Jevos,Heavies
Sweden: Hårdrockare
Ukraine: Metalist
USA: Metalheads, or headbangers
Yugoslavia (and also Croatia) Metalaci
